на главную
к оглавлению

1.4.4.3. Расчёт подачи при линейно-круговой интерполяции.

       Подача, запрограммированная для линейно-круговой интерполяции, является для УЧПУ подачей вдоль винтовой линии.

       Если линейно-круговая интерполяция задана тремя линейными координатами, то подача вдоль винтовой линии автоматически раскладывается на линейную и круговую составляющие, с тем, чтобы на один шаг винта по линейной оси выполнялась полная окружность в плоскости круговой интерполяции (Рис. 3).

       Где,
       F(К) - подача, запрограммированная в кадре;
       F(Л) - линейная составляющая подачи;
       F(КР) - круговая составляющая подачи;
       К - абсолютная величина шага линейно-круговой интерполяции;
       R - величина радиуса круговой интерполяции.

       Для круговой составляющей справедливо соотношение пункта 1.4.4.2.

       Программирование линейно-круговой интерполяции позволяет задать перемещение по круговой оси в качестве "Линейной оси".

       Траектория движения инструмента в этом случае имеет сложную форму и определяется различными комбинациями поворотных и линейных осей.

       Понятие "Винт" здесь применяется условно.

       Устройство ЧПУ рассчитывает составляющие подачи по формулам, приведённым выше, но подача в точке резания будет ещё зависеть от расстояния от центра поворотного стола.

       Расчёт величины подачи, которую нужно задать в кадре, показан на следующем примере:

       Пример:

       В качестве "линейной" оси используется ось В (Рис. 4).

       УЧПУ рассчитывает подачу для круговой оси В по формуле:

       где, К - шаг по оси, град.

       Подача, с которой будет перемещаться центр круговой интерполяции (не инструмент):

       Если F(Ц) считать заданной технологической подачей, то программная подача F(К) определяется по формуле:

       Примечание:

       Рисунок показывает не реальную траекторию, а схему перемещений осей. Радиус круговой интерполяции R и подача F(КР) связаны соотношением Пункта 1.4.4.2.



.
Яндекс.Метрика